SQL Developer是一款由Oracle開發(fā)的集成開發(fā)環(huán)境(IDE),用于開發(fā)和管理Oracle數(shù)據(jù)庫。它提供了許多功能,包括:
SQL開發(fā):可以通過SQL語句對(duì)數(shù)據(jù)庫進(jìn)行查詢、插入、更新和刪除操作,還可以編寫存儲(chǔ)過程、函數(shù)和觸發(fā)器。
數(shù)據(jù)庫對(duì)象管理:可以創(chuàng)建、修改和刪除數(shù)據(jù)庫對(duì)象,如表、索引、視圖、序列等。
數(shù)據(jù)模型管理:可以創(chuàng)建和修改數(shù)據(jù)庫的物理和邏輯數(shù)據(jù)模型,包括表、列、關(guān)系和約束等。
數(shù)據(jù)導(dǎo)入和導(dǎo)出:可以將數(shù)據(jù)從外部文件導(dǎo)入到數(shù)據(jù)庫中,或?qū)?shù)據(jù)庫中的數(shù)據(jù)導(dǎo)出到外部文件中。
數(shù)據(jù)庫比較和同步:可以比較兩個(gè)數(shù)據(jù)庫之間的結(jié)構(gòu)和數(shù)據(jù)差異,并將其同步。
查詢優(yōu)化和執(zhí)行計(jì)劃分析:可以分析查詢語句的性能,找出潛在的優(yōu)化機(jī)會(huì)。
數(shù)據(jù)庫連接和會(huì)話管理:可以連接到多個(gè)數(shù)據(jù)庫實(shí)例,并管理數(shù)據(jù)庫會(huì)話。
報(bào)表和圖形化展示:可以生成和展示數(shù)據(jù)庫的報(bào)表和圖形化統(tǒng)計(jì)信息。
調(diào)試和性能分析:可以調(diào)試存儲(chǔ)過程和觸發(fā)器,并進(jìn)行性能分析。
數(shù)據(jù)庫安全管理:可以管理用戶、角色和權(quán)限,保證數(shù)據(jù)庫的安全性。
這些是SQL Developer的一些主要功能,它還提供了許多其他輔助功能,以幫助開發(fā)人員更高效地使用和管理Oracle數(shù)據(jù)庫。